In "Dred" Vol. II, Harriet Beecher Stowe delves deeper into the harrowing journey of Dred, a courageous and morally driven enslaved man who seeks freedom and justice. The narrative exposes the brutal realities of slavery, exploring themes of resistance, human dignity, and the fight for liberation. Through powerful storytelling and vivid characters, the book amplifies the voices of the oppressed, challenging readers to confront the moral injustices of the system and inspiring a call for compassion and change.Dred - Vol. II is an unchanged, high-quality reprint of the original edition of 1856.
